Saint Matthew Church  |  Forestville, CT

  • Scope:
  • • New 920 Seat, 14500 square foot Church
  • • Nave, Sanctuary
  • • Daily Chapel
  • • Sacristies
  • • Conference Rooms
  • • Public and Administrative Facilities

The project entailed the demolition of an existing church and re-use of key elements in the new structure, including granite and strained glass. Unique interior strategies included utilizing a stained glass wall between the main sanctuary and daily chapel to both connect and separate the different worship spaces. Salvaged historic elements, including stained glass and granite steps, were incorporated the into new church.

An extremely tight budget required a knowledgeable and creative approaches to structure, construction and finishes. By employing a steel frame and laminated wood girder structure clad in veneer brick, a favorable cost per square foot was realized while providing quality construction. The natural finish afforded by the laminated wood structure and exposed timber deck ceiling worked with the interior brick finish to create a warm and powerful interior.
